GlassChampagne flute
GarnishLemon twist
Serves1
Ingredients
30ml gin
15ml fresh lemon juice
10ml simple syrup
60ml Champagne (or sparkling wine)
Method
Shake gin, lemon juice, and syrup with ice. Strain into a Champagne flute. Top with Champagne. Garnish with a lemon twist.
